About So-Hee Lee

So-Hee Lee is a scholar working on Immunology and Allergy, Physiology, Emergency Medical Services, Dermatology and Pulmonary and Respiratory Medicine, having authored 29 papers that have together received 462 indexed citations. Recurring topics across this work include Asthma and respiratory diseases (12 papers), Drug-Induced Adverse Reactions (4 papers), Food Allergy and Anaphylaxis Research (4 papers), Chronic Obstructive Pulmonary Disease (COPD) Research (4 papers), Respiratory and Cough-Related Research (3 papers), Pediatric health and respiratory diseases (3 papers), Contact Dermatitis and Allergies (2 papers) and Atomic and Subatomic Physics Research (2 papers). The work is most often cited by research in Immunology and Allergy (145 citations), Dermatology (87 citations), Physiology (164 citations), Pharmacology (72 citations) and Pulmonary and Respiratory Medicine (112 citations). So-Hee Lee has collaborated with scholars based in South Korea, Ethiopia and Puerto Rico. Frequent co-authors include Heung‐Woo Park, Sang‐Heon Cho, Sun-Sin Kim, Sae‐Hoon Kim, Yoon‐Seok Chang, Sang Min Lee, Kyung-Up Min, Kyung‐Up Min, Hye‐Ryun Kang and Min‐Suk Yang. Their work appears in journals such as Annals of Allergy Asthma & Immunology, Allergy Asthma and Immunology Research, Journal of Clinical Immunology, World Allergy Organization Journal and Hepatology International.
